Commit Graph

  • b1a0cdb195 chore: gen api-client v0.29.1-beta.2 v0.29.1 Nicolas Meienberger 2026-02-25 23:19:02 +01:00
  • 907bc57c2d fix(restic-dto): allow missing current_files in schema v0.29.1-beta.1 Nicolas Meienberger 2026-02-25 23:07:53 +01:00
  • d533e470fc chore: bump rclone to 1.73.1 v0.29.0-beta.2 v0.29.0 Nicolas Meienberger 2026-02-25 22:17:24 +01:00
  • f3c753ad30 chore: style fixes Nicolas Meienberger 2026-02-25 22:15:08 +01:00
  • c959fb77cf ci: parallelize ci checks (#577) Nico 2026-02-25 21:18:18 +01:00
  • 5bc0de4d1a chore(deps): bump the minor-patch group with 6 updates (#570) v0.29.0-beta.1 dependabot[bot] 2026-02-25 19:19:00 +01:00
  • c4f3300e9b fix(backups): correctly resolve paths when folder name matches volume name (#576) Nico 2026-02-25 19:09:32 +01:00
  • cc55fee339 refactor: increase rclone mount timeout (#575) Nico 2026-02-25 19:06:07 +01:00
  • dd9083ce7a fix: wrong cache key for snapshot retention tags (#574) Nico 2026-02-25 19:02:44 +01:00
  • 29967d7e4e fix(discord): do not split each line into individual messages (#573) Nico 2026-02-25 18:54:56 +01:00
  • b916df7736 fix: form not correctly updating based on values (#572) Nico 2026-02-25 18:36:12 +01:00
  • cb92d36c95 feat: cache backup progress (#571) Nico 2026-02-25 18:20:08 +01:00
  • 00e7118771 fix: report timeout as errors (#569) Nico 2026-02-25 18:02:47 +01:00
  • 5b8f05bdf8 chore(deps): bump the minor-patch group across 1 directory with 18 updates (#566) dependabot[bot] 2026-02-24 19:05:53 +01:00
  • e870cdc815 WIP refactor/controller-agent Nicolas Meienberger 2026-02-24 19:02:25 +01:00
  • d4f585d5c8 chore: fix lint issues Nicolas Meienberger 2026-02-23 21:24:52 +01:00
  • 2d2183baaf refactor: cleanup / pr review Nicolas Meienberger 2026-02-23 21:06:07 +01:00
  • 5e4f3fca62 refactor: restrict provider configuration to super admins only Nicolas Meienberger 2026-02-23 20:23:54 +01:00
  • efc112820d refactor: user existing check Nicolas Meienberger 2026-02-23 20:23:48 +01:00
  • a30af6026d refactor: code style Nicolas Meienberger 2026-02-22 21:54:01 +01:00
  • de34fd841c feat: per-user account management Nicolas Meienberger 2026-02-22 21:32:53 +01:00
  • 0bf0094dbd refactor: own page for sso registration Nicolas Meienberger 2026-02-22 20:41:47 +01:00
  • 4619d9d976 feat: link current account Nicolas Meienberger 2026-02-22 10:08:01 +01:00
  • a3af29ec4e feat: oidc Nicolas Meienberger 2026-02-14 15:43:24 +01:00
  • 74b21d93d6 fix: add DisableTLS param if server is http (#563) Nico 2026-02-23 21:31:53 +01:00
  • ebefe410f4 refactor: react-doctor 02-19-refactor_react-doctor Nicolas Meienberger 2026-02-19 19:05:17 +01:00
  • a0a813ed09 refactor: short id branded type (#552) Nico 2026-02-21 11:16:15 +01:00
  • 45fd9f9de1 feat: repository used space (#551) Nico 2026-02-21 10:52:55 +01:00
  • 182d39a887 feat: restore snapshot as tar (#550) Nico 2026-02-21 10:19:20 +01:00
  • 8681ebc0c0 refactor: always use short id in api calls (#545) Nico 2026-02-19 20:08:40 +01:00
  • f3608b0f30 docs: update TROUBLESHOOTING.md with LOG_LEVEL instruction Nicolas Meienberger 2026-02-18 21:55:46 +01:00
  • 8fcd446926 refactor: snapshot strip out base path (#542) Nico 2026-02-18 21:45:19 +01:00
  • ca8248b2a0 ui: scroll to error (#541) Nico 2026-02-18 20:13:09 +01:00
  • 505f60a8a1 docs: update readme version Nicolas Meienberger 2026-02-17 20:58:32 +01:00
  • 705f5c75cb chore: remove useless migration normalization v0.28.2 Nicolas Meienberger 2026-02-17 20:50:23 +01:00
  • 1321b15c0d chore: revert drizzle-orm to previous version v0.28.2-beta.4 Nicolas Meienberger 2026-02-17 20:33:24 +01:00
  • 289832d58b e2e: fix flaky tests by adding page readiness chaeck v0.28.2-beta.3 Nicolas Meienberger 2026-02-17 20:13:19 +01:00
  • 85e2272a5c fix(ui): missing @container class in backup details Nicolas Meienberger 2026-02-17 19:22:15 +01:00
  • c04219cbf7 fix: normalize drizzle migration timestamp v0.28.2-beta.2 Nicolas Meienberger 2026-02-17 19:05:52 +01:00
  • d3be8e7a42 chore: add back e2e tests in release workflow Nicolas Meienberger 2026-02-17 18:47:36 +01:00
  • f059a23ecc fix: multiple mobile and responsiveness issues (#537) v0.28.2-beta.1 Nico 2026-02-17 18:44:22 +01:00
  • 16df0dc875 chore(deps): bump the minor-patch group across 1 directory with 11 updates (#535) dependabot[bot] 2026-02-17 18:33:11 +01:00
  • ebfafa4143 fix(repositories): append short id when using the default path for local repos (#536) Nico 2026-02-17 18:28:33 +01:00
  • 0bbdbc85ad Reapply "chore(deps): bump drizzle-orm from 1.0.0-beta.9-e89174b to 1.0.0-beta.15-859cf75 (#501)" Nicolas Meienberger 2026-02-17 17:52:25 +01:00
  • 440916e312 ci: skip e2e temporarily v0.28.1-beta.2 v0.28.1 Nicolas Meienberger 2026-02-16 23:59:08 +01:00
  • d58329d86e fix: skip migrating imported repos v0.28.1-beta.1 Nicolas Meienberger 2026-02-16 23:50:39 +01:00
  • a70e95fb7e chore: enable foreign keys constraints in CLI runs v0.28.0 Nicolas Meienberger 2026-02-16 23:29:36 +01:00
  • 7bcf380198 test: fix impossible test scenarios v0.28.0-beta.6 Nicolas Meienberger 2026-02-16 23:20:33 +01:00
  • 11efe87b2e fix: apply fk db constraint on app creation Nicolas Meienberger 2026-02-16 22:20:57 +01:00
  • 0d07f9c4a7 chore: run db migrations on page load v0.28.0-beta.5 Nicolas Meienberger 2026-02-16 22:20:57 +01:00
  • db163a1bb5 Revert "chore(deps): bump drizzle-orm from 1.0.0-beta.9-e89174b to 1.0.0-beta.15-859cf75 (#501)" v0.28.0-beta.4 Nicolas Meienberger 2026-02-16 22:17:47 +01:00
  • 6733151bca refactor: only set pragma on server start v0.28.0-beta.3 Nicolas Meienberger 2026-02-16 21:57:14 +01:00
  • bf82bbf48a test(e2e): ensure cascade delete works v0.28.0-beta.2 Nicolas Meienberger 2026-02-16 21:41:52 +01:00
  • dda7b9939f refactor: allow more characters in usernames (#529) v0.28.0-beta.1 Nico 2026-02-16 21:37:15 +01:00
  • 99bb296866 fix: cascade delete not correctly applied (#531) Nico 2026-02-16 21:36:07 +01:00
  • de1278a416 refactor: rename DATABASE_URL -> ZEROBYTE_DATABASE_URL (#528) Nico 2026-02-16 19:43:43 +01:00
  • 66ed89d39e fix(file-tree): display load more if root folder has 500+ items (#526) Nico 2026-02-16 19:25:41 +01:00
  • fdd8edec70 chore(deps): bump the minor-patch group across 1 directory with 11 updates (#514) dependabot[bot] 2026-02-14 14:42:45 +01:00
  • 39ae0cfe6d fix: remove trailing slash or space before constructing s3 uri (#516) Nico 2026-02-14 14:18:36 +01:00
  • d53b24bfb4 chore(deps): bump drizzle-orm from 1.0.0-beta.9-e89174b to 1.0.0-beta.15-859cf75 (#501) dependabot[bot] 2026-02-14 14:18:20 +01:00
  • ed250ba03d chore(deps-dev): bump drizzle-kit (#502) dependabot[bot] 2026-02-14 13:55:31 +01:00
  • 8e5eb68935 refactor: optimistic ui when deleting a snapshot (#515) Nico 2026-02-14 13:47:09 +01:00
  • bad944a232 feat: restore progress (#281) Nico 2026-02-14 12:35:16 +01:00
  • 1017f1a38b feat: edit repository form (#507) Nico 2026-02-14 11:49:33 +01:00
  • 60c8bd77f5 chore: bump shoutrrr to v0.13.2 v0.27.0 Nicolas Meienberger 2026-02-13 22:07:10 +01:00
  • 38c1cf4373 ci: don't block build on anchore alerts Nicolas Meienberger 2026-02-13 22:01:18 +01:00
  • a4fbe3c8df remove proxy pattern in db and auth (#513) v0.27.0-beta.8 v0.27.0-beta.7 Nico 2026-02-13 21:18:40 +01:00
  • 1efc4c3328 refactor: remove proxy pattern for db and auth v0.27.0-beta.6 Nicolas Meienberger 2026-02-13 21:08:58 +01:00
  • 48b3c9a87f refactor: extract common setup in initModule function v0.27.0-beta.5 Nicolas Meienberger 2026-02-13 20:53:15 +01:00
  • 297e14ebb2 refactor: add nitro bootstrap plugin to ensure app is started before first call (#512) Nico 2026-02-13 20:46:10 +01:00
  • ca2a2cb74f refactor(bootstrap): avoid duplicate event firing v0.27.0-beta.4 Nicolas Meienberger 2026-02-13 20:37:12 +01:00
  • 436a63a4b4 refactor: add nitro bootstrap plugin to ensure app is started before first call v0.27.0-beta.3 Nicolas Meienberger 2026-02-13 20:20:16 +01:00
  • 1fea2a729a e2e: fix tests v0.27.0-beta.2 Nicolas Meienberger 2026-02-13 19:12:41 +01:00
  • 613f380ea7 chore: downgrade bun to v1.3.6 again due to user crashes Nicolas 2026-02-13 18:39:12 +01:00
  • 0cf5358f77 ci: fix linting issues v0.27.0-beta.1 Nicolas 2026-02-13 18:33:34 +01:00
  • 6d33a3a35e refactor: remove delete option until we have a proper dry-run mode Nicolas 2026-02-13 18:31:06 +01:00
  • 71f72bd09b fix: use 127.0.0.1 when making server to server requests Nicolas 2026-02-13 18:25:03 +01:00
  • ec4cf938bc feat: show progress indicator on mirrors (#499) Nico 2026-02-12 22:27:30 +01:00
  • 7ebce1166b feat: expand snapshot details with additional info (#505) Nico 2026-02-12 18:25:21 +01:00
  • 07aa2bf768 chore(deps): bump the minor-patch group with 21 updates (#500) dependabot[bot] 2026-02-12 07:55:17 +01:00
  • 825d46c934 refactor: react-router -> tanstack start (#498) Nico 2026-02-11 21:41:06 +01:00
  • b45d36e06a refactor: make lock errors cleaner and show unlock button (#493) Nico 2026-02-10 20:18:25 +01:00
  • cb7988b8ed refactor(retention badges): use restic forget dry run result instead of manual calc (#494) Nico 2026-02-10 20:14:35 +01:00
  • 12d0eda6ef feat: dev panel (#489) Nico 2026-02-09 22:04:21 +01:00
  • 413e86b8b9 ci: create a nightly build pipeline (#487) Nico 2026-02-09 18:21:37 +01:00
  • 124b8f4081 fix: make retention badge clickable for mobile devices (#486) Nico 2026-02-09 18:15:34 +01:00
  • 81d3a76518 chore: bump Bun to 1.3.9 v0.26.0-beta.2 v0.26.0 Nicolas Meienberger 2026-02-08 16:44:20 +01:00
  • 2d0ae89727 fix: get volume if short id is only numbers v0.26.0-beta.1 Nicolas Meienberger 2026-02-08 16:33:32 +01:00
  • 09c1cbbb94 feat: show retention tags in snapshots timeline (#462) Nico 2026-02-08 16:14:43 +01:00
  • 0e0eaea946 refactor: split backups module + unit tests (#463) Nico 2026-02-03 23:00:25 +01:00
  • cb9186adc0 docs(troubleshooting): add section about rclon sftp v0.25.1 Nicolas Meienberger 2026-02-02 21:27:26 +01:00
  • f2ede26af7 fix(create-repo): directory selection v0.25.1-beta.1 Nicolas Meienberger 2026-02-02 20:34:37 +01:00
  • aafed6e7b1 fix: downgrade bun to 1.3.6 Nicolas Meienberger 2026-02-02 18:20:45 +01:00
  • 1e5921fa61 fix(create-repo): directory selection Nicolas Meienberger 2026-02-02 20:34:37 +01:00
  • cc081ca64c fix: downgrade bun to 1.3.6 Nicolas Meienberger 2026-02-02 18:20:45 +01:00
  • 17b4027e0b refactor: split create schedule form (#453) Nico 2026-02-02 18:18:14 +01:00
  • 9c82140072 fix: add restic --host to repo init command fix/restic-init-host Nicolas Meienberger 2026-02-02 18:17:19 +01:00
  • 35773a6969 refactor: upgrade to drizzle v1 (#450) Nico 2026-02-01 19:14:52 +01:00
  • 36b1282901 chore: downgrade bun to v1.3.6 v0.25.1-alpha.1 Nicolas Meienberger 2026-02-01 18:57:00 +01:00
  • ebdca8870b docs(troubleshooting): fix anchors Nicolas Meienberger 2026-02-01 12:01:58 +01:00